Steps to Obtain a Norwegian Driving License
The procedure of acquiring a driving license in Norway can be boiled down to numerous key steps:
1. Requirements
To make an application for a driving license, you need to:
Be at least 18 years of ages for Class B, 16 for Class A1 (light bikes), and 24 for Class A (heavy bikes).Have valid identification and residency status in Norway.2. Theoretical Examination
Candidates should pass a theoretical exam that covers traffic rules, guidelines, and safe driving practices. The examination can be taken in numerous languages, which reduces the procedure for non-Norwegian speakers.
3. Practical Training
Registering in a driving school is highly advised, although it is not necessary. Professional trainers provide indispensable insights that can considerably boost the quality of your driving.
4. Practical Driving Test
After successfully finishing the theoretical test and useful training, prospects need to pass a useful driving test. This test examines driving abilities in real-world circumstances, focusing on both technical and situational awareness.
5. Issuance of License
Upon successfully passing both tests, candidates can obtain their driving license through the Norwegian Public Roads Administration (Statens vegvesen). The license will be released once all costs are paid, and identification validated.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)Q1: Can I drive in Norway with an international driving permit?
A1: Yes, you can drive in Norway with a global driving permit (IDP) for approximately three months. After that, you need to obtain a Norwegian license if you prepare to reside in the nation.
Q2: Can I transform my foreign driving license to a Norwegian one?
A2: Yes, some nations have agreements with Norway that enable for the conversion of foreign licenses to Norwegian licenses. However, you may require to take a theoretical and/or useful test.
Q3: What occurs if I fail the driving test?
A3: If you stop working the driving test, you can retake it after a specified period. It's recommended to get extra practice and possibly more training before attempting once again.
Q4: How long is a Norwegian driving license valid?
A4: A Norwegian driving license is typically valid for 15 years, after which it should be restored.
